Description

Kutaro is a little boy taken away by the evil Moon Bear King. He must escape the king's castle and rescue his fellow little comrades with the help of a mysterious flying cat and a pair of magic scissors called 'Calibrus'. Transformed into a puppet by the evil king, Kutaro must play with his wooden head and the numerous replacement heads he will find on his way to help him out the castle.

Puppeteer is a side-scrolling platformer that can be played in both 2D and 3D. The puzzle-solving elements in the game are based around the various heads that can be picked up and up to three can be carried at a single time. Encounters with enemies and hazards cause Kutaro to lose his head and it then needs to be picked up quickly before it disappears. Extra lives are provided by collecting 100 moonsparkles.

Kutaro has a companion and both characters are controlled simultaneously with an analog stick for each one. The game supports two players where the second takes control of the companion. There are different companions in the game and they can examine objects, and pick up moonsparkles and heads. The game is presented as a puppet show with seven acts and three 'curtains' (levels) for each act.
